Microchip MCP604T-I/ST Quad Op-Amp: Features, Applications, and Technical Specifications

The Microchip MCP604T-I/ST is a quad operational amplifier (op-amp) that stands out in the realm of low-power analog integrated circuits. Designed for applications where power consumption is a critical constraint, this device combines exceptional performance with minimal energy requirements, making it a preferred choice for battery-powered and portable electronics.

Key Features

One of the most significant attributes of the MCP604T-I/ST is its ultra-low quiescent current, typically drawing just 600 nanoamps per amplifier. This remarkably low power consumption does not come at the expense of functionality. The op-amp operates on a single supply voltage ranging from 1.4V to 6.0V, providing design flexibility for both 3.3V and 5V systems. Furthermore, it features rail-to-rail input and output operation, enabling the amplifiers to utilize the entire supply voltage range for signal swing, which is crucial for maximizing dynamic range in low-voltage applications. The device is also characterized by a low input bias current and stable operation with high capacitive loads.

Primary Applications

The combination of low power and rail-to-rail capability makes the MCP604T-I/ST exceptionally versatile. Its primary application domains include:

Battery-Powered Equipment: It is ideal for portable instrumentation, medical sensors, smoke detectors, and remote data loggers where extending battery life is paramount.

Sensor Interface and Signal Conditioning: The op-amp is perfectly suited for amplifying small signals from transducers, photodiode amplifiers, pressure sensors, and thermocouples.

Active Filtering: Its stability makes it a good candidate for implementing Sallen-Key and other active filter topologies in power-sensitive systems.

Analog-to-Digital Converter (ADC) Buffering: The rail-to- output swing ensures the full-scale input range of an ADC is used efficiently, improving system resolution.

Technical Specifications

Number of Channels: 4 (Quad)

Supply Voltage Range: 1.4V to 6.0V

Quiescent Current (Typ.): 600 nA per amplifier

Gain Bandwidth Product: 14 kHz (Typ.)

Input Offset Voltage: 500 µV (Max.)

Input Bias Current: 1 pA (Typ.)

Output Swing: Rail-to-Rail

Operating Temperature Range: -40°C to +85°C (Industrial)

Package: TSSOP-14
